A Certificate in Substance Abuse Counseling is a specialized program designed to provide individuals with the knowledge and skills necessary to support individuals dealing with substance abuse and addiction. This certification course typically covers a range of topics related to addiction counseling, mental health, and therapeutic interventions. The curriculum often includes foundational knowledge about various substances of abuse, the physiological and psychological effects of addiction, and the impact of substance abuse on individuals, families, and communities. Participants learn about different models of addiction, theories of counseling, and evidence-based practices in the field of substance abuse treatment. Counseling techniques and interpersonal skills are a significant focus of the program. Participants are trained in effective communication, motivational interviewing, and counseling strategies tailored to individuals struggling with substance abuse. The coursework may also address co-occurring disorders, understanding the intersection of mental health issues with substance use. Ethical considerations and legal aspects of substance abuse counseling are typically covered, emphasizing the importance of maintaining confidentiality, respecting clients' rights, and understanding the legal frameworks that govern addiction counseling. Practical experience and supervised internships are often incorporated into the program, allowing participants to apply their knowledge in real-world counseling settings. This hands-on experience is crucial for developing the practical skills and empathy required in substance abuse counseling. Upon successful completion of the Certificate in Substance Abuse Counseling, individuals may pursue entry-level positions as substance abuse counselors, case managers, or behavioral health technicians in a variety of settings such as rehabilitation centers, community health organizations, or mental health facilities. While this certificate provides foundational skills, it's important to note that more advanced roles may require further education and licensure. Overall, this certification equips individuals with the necessary tools to make a positive impact on the lives of those struggling with substance abuse issues.
